Packaging on the Odesa coast has become more expensive

(Paid parking lots near the beach in Odesa. PHOTOS: Suspilne Odesa)

The Executive Committee of the Odesa City Council has set the cost of parking in the city's parking lots near the coast at UAH 60 per hour.

Accenture has found out how this will affect citizens and tourists.

At the same time, Petro Obukhov, a deputy of the Odesa City Council, noted that the tariff has decreased - last year it was UAH 100. Instead, the city council plans to remove barriers and replace them with city parking inspectors. The parking lots will be operated by Odesmiskparservis, a municipal utility company.

"For the past 10 years, when Trukhanov was mayor, all seaside parking lots were operated by some private entrepreneurs who received them and their management without a tender and made money on it. Yes, they paid a parking fee to the budget, which was about a hryvnia or so per square meter per day, but it was, I don't know, 2% of what they earned. Despite the fact that the land is not leased. It is not owned by these private entrepreneurs. So this year, we decided to finally do the right thing and make sure that the city, the city budget, earns money from city parking lots. This is a complicated process. First, we determined the traffic organization scheme, how many parking spaces there are, how it will be organized, and whether there will be no barriers, as there were in previous years. Then we decided on the tariff. The parking lots will be open from 8:00 am to 8:00 pm, seven days a week, from May 1 to September 30. That is, in winter and in late fall, parking will be free. The penalty for non-payment for parking is 20 tariffs, i.e. 2 thousand 100 hryvnias. Or if you pay within the first 10 days, it will be 600 hryvnias. It is more profitable to pay to the budget. According to my conservative estimate, this story will bring about 20 million hryvnias to the city budget, at least."

Petro Obukhov

The deputy is confident that the new tariff will lead to full occupancy of parking lots. The executive committee also learned that the most profitable parking lot was decided to be left under the operation of a private individual entrepreneur, but they plan to make it a public utility.
